12 changes for Dublin hurlers as Maguire, Boland, Sutcliffe and Dotsy all return

Dublin’s second Walsh Cup game is on next Sunday in Walsh Park.

DUBLIN HAVE WELCOMED back several leading lights into their team for Sunday’s Walsh Cup tie against Antrim in Parnell Park.

Dublin got the Ger Cunningham era off to a flying start with a comprehensive win over Dublin IT in their opening group game last Tuesday night in Parnell Park.

Only three players keep their place from the side that won that game – defenders Michael Carton and Peter Kelly, and full-forward Liam Rushe.

Cunningham brings back several big names including 2011 Allstar Gary Maguire, midfield Joey Boland, 2013 Allstar Danny Sutcliffe and attacker David O’Callaghan.
